Product Description:
The KDA 3.1-050-3-AQI-U1 is a spindle drive produced by Bosch Rexroth Indramat and delivered within the KDA Spindle Drives series. In machining centers and other automated tooling stations, the unit converts analog speed reference signals into controlled three-phase output for high-speed motorized spindles, providing the torque and velocity regulation required for consistent cutting quality. The designation “3.1” reflects its firmware and hardware combination designed for cabinet mounting alongside other Indramat power modules.
Its output capability is anchored by a rated current of 50 A, allowing the drive to energize medium-frame spindle motors without saturation. The power section is supplied from a regulated intermediate circuit at 300 VDC, so the converter must be paired with a matching mains rectifier module. A dedicated heatsink blower runs from a separate 115V/50-60 Hz AC source; this auxiliary circuit supports the drive’s Mounted Heatsink Blower architecture. Because thermal energy is extracted through Forced Cooling, continuous operation at high switching frequencies can be maintained even inside densely populated cabinets. Hardware revision indicator “3” identifies the functional generation inside the KDA lineage.
The drive can be installed in production areas kept between 5 to 45 °C; operation outside this window may require derating or auxiliary conditioning. Altitude is limited to 1000 m above sea level so that internal components see no excessive reduction in air density. For feedback distribution, an incremental encoder output passes spindle position data to external positioning controls, while the speed loop accepts a analogue command value that ranges from –10 V to +10 V. These environmental and signaling constraints define safe integration limits for revision 3 units in the KDA Spindle Drives series.
